/*++ Copyright (c) 2006 Microsoft Corporation Module Name: foreach_file.cpp Abstract: Traverse files in a directory that match a given suffix. Apply a method to each of the files. Author: Nikolaj Bjorner (nbjorner) 2006-11-3. Revision History: --*/ #ifdef _WINDOWS #include #include #include #include "for_each_file.h" bool for_each_file(for_each_file_proc& proc, const char* base, const char* suffix) { std::string pattern(base); pattern += "\\"; pattern += suffix; char buffer[MAX_PATH]; WIN32_FIND_DATAA data; HANDLE h = FindFirstFileA(pattern.c_str(),&data); while (h != INVALID_HANDLE_VALUE) { StringCchPrintfA(buffer, ARRAYSIZE(buffer), "%s\\%s", base, data.cFileName); if (!proc(buffer)) { return false; } if (!FindNextFileA(h,&data)) { break; } } // // Now recurse through sub-directories. // pattern = base; pattern += "\\*"; h = FindFirstFileA(pattern.c_str(),&data); while (h != INVALID_HANDLE_VALUE) { if ((data.dwFileAttributes & FILE_ATTRIBUTE_DIRECTORY) && data.cFileName[0] != '.' ){ std::string subdir(base); subdir += "\\"; subdir += data.cFileName; if (!for_each_file(proc, subdir.c_str(), suffix)) { return false; } } if (!FindNextFileA(h,&data)) { break; } } return true; }; #endif
